One tool that has revolutionized the industry is the wire eroder, also known as wire EDM (electrical discharge machining) machines. These cutting-edge machines use a thin wire electrode to cut through metal with extreme precision, making them an invaluable asset for any manufacturing operation.
wire eroders work by using electrical discharges to erode away the metal material, creating intricate and precise cuts that are impossible to achieve with traditional cutting methods. The thin wire electrode is guided by computer-controlled movements, allowing for highly accurate and repeatable cuts. This level of precision is essential for creating complex shapes and designs, particularly in industries such as aerospace, automotive, and medical device manufacturing.
One of the biggest benefits of wire eroders is their ability to cut through hard materials with ease. Whether it’s hardened steel, titanium, or exotic alloys, wire EDM machines can slice through these tough materials like a hot knife through butter. This flexibility makes them incredibly versatile and ideal for a wide range of applications.
Another advantage of wire eroders is their ability to produce fine finishes and tight tolerances. The cutting process does not produce any burrs or chips, resulting in smooth and polished surfaces that require minimal post-processing. This can save manufacturers time and money by reducing the need for secondary finishing operations.
wire eroders are also known for their high efficiency and productivity. The non-contact cutting method minimizes tool wear and allows for fast cutting speeds, leading to shorter lead times and increased production output. Additionally, the CNC (computer numerical control) capabilities of wire EDM machines enable operators to program complex cutting paths and shapes, further enhancing productivity.
